Global Fish Feed Market - Key Trends & Drivers Summarized
How Is the Fish Feed Industry Evolving with Innovation in Aquaculture?
The fish feed market is undergoing transformative shifts in response to the rapid intensification of aquaculture and the increasing pressure to meet sustainability benchmarks. Traditionally reliant on fishmeal and fish oil derived from wild-caught fish, the industry is transitioning toward alternative protein sources such as insect meal, microbial protein, algae-based ingredients, and plant-derived substitutes. This change is not only cost-motivated but also driven by environmental and regulatory imperatives. Start-ups and established feed manufacturers alike are leveraging biotechnological tools to enhance digestibility, optimize feed conversion ratios, and reduce the ecological footprint of aquafeeds.Additionally, the growing popularity of carnivorous species such as salmon, trout, and seabass, which demand protein-rich feed, has prompted the formulation of specialized feed types catering to species-specific nutritional profiles. Feed customization is becoming a competitive differentiator, with companies deploying advanced R&D capabilities to deliver feeds tailored for different growth stages, water temperatures, and farming environments. This trend is especially prevalent in regions witnessing a surge in intensive aquaculture, where productivity and disease management are of critical concern.
What Role Does Precision Nutrition Play in Shaping Feed Formulations?
Precision nutrition is reshaping fish feed production, aiming to deliver targeted health benefits and enhance production efficiency. Formulators are employing data analytics, metabolomics, and gut microbiome profiling to develop feeds that optimize metabolic performance, immune response, and nutrient absorption. Functional ingredients such as probiotics, prebiotics, phytogenics, and immunostimulants are increasingly incorporated into feed blends to reduce dependency on antibiotics and chemical treatments, which aligns with global sustainability goals and food safety regulations.Another growing aspect of precision nutrition is the move toward personalized aquafeed solutions that account for site-specific and breed-specific requirements. This is supported by the integration of aquaculture management software and digital feed monitoring systems, which enable real-time assessment of feed utilization and fish health parameters. Such innovations help minimize feed wastage and water contamination, thereby lowering operating costs and enhancing sustainability credentials. Feed manufacturers are also focusing on pellet durability and water stability to reduce nutrient leaching and preserve feed integrity under variable farming conditions.
Which End-Use Developments Are Driving Demand Diversification?
Aquaculture diversification is driving the need for a broader array of fish feed products across different market segments. While marine species continue to be the dominant consumers of high-performance feed, freshwater species such as tilapia, catfish, and carp are gaining prominence due to their adaptability to varied farming systems. This shift is particularly noticeable in Asia-Pacific and parts of Latin America, where the push for low-cost, protein-rich diets is creating a robust demand for floating and sinking feed variants tailored to regional species.Integrated aquaculture models such as fish-rice farming and aquaponics are also creating demand for feed products with minimal environmental discharge and enhanced nutrient retention. In parallel, ornamental fish feed is emerging as a niche but high-value segment, necessitating aesthetically appealing and nutritionally balanced micro-pellets. Additionally, recirculating aquaculture systems (RAS), which require highly controlled environments, are influencing feed specifications to reduce ammonia emissions and maximize nutrient uptake under low-flow conditions. Such end-use developments are reshaping feed manufacturing priorities, encouraging innovation in feed delivery technologies such as auto-feeders and programmable dispersal systems.
What Are the Concrete Factors Fueling the Growth of the Fish Feed Market?
The growth in the fish feed market is driven by several factors rooted in aquaculture intensification, technological advancements, and species diversification. A significant driver is the rising global consumption of fish protein, which is pushing aquafarms to scale up production, thereby increasing feed demand. Parallelly, the shift toward sustainable and traceable feed ingredients such as algal oils and insect meals is gaining traction as feed formulators respond to ecological concerns and regulatory scrutiny.Furthermore, the adoption of smart aquaculture technologies, including IoT-based feeding systems, AI-powered farm monitoring, and automated feeding algorithms, is transforming how feed is administered, improving efficiency and reducing loss. Regulatory bans on antibiotics and medicated feed in several countries have accelerated the adoption of health-oriented functional feeds. Additionally, the proliferation of aquaculture clusters and public-private investments in feed manufacturing infrastructure particularly in emerging markets are creating favorable conditions for supply chain expansion. The rising emphasis on feed quality, traceability, and performance metrics will continue to steer market momentum, making fish feed a pivotal component of the evolving blue economy.
